Principle of Association

                                  "You can measure a person's growth through life
                                     by their successive choirs of friends."

                                                                                                Emerson

                                     The principle of Association in life teaches us that,
                                     "We become like the people that we associate with."

                                     We become better ourselves by connecting with people
                                     whose values we respect. Connecting with others who
                                     are trying to do their best helps us be our best.

                                     Joining together with others of similar values is a good way
                                     to help us grow in strength.   They help us hold the course
                                     in the times when we slip, get confused or knocked down.

                                     And a shared sense of good purpose works through us
                                     ever more powerfully, inspiring and empowering each of
                                     us to help each other and others use our lives for good.
                                     That's how goodness grows. And growing toward goodness
                                     is what self-actualization is all about.
